Output 38c8feed0e18cc12579aeeca6d98a7aa28873722dbc43d9139d78acd1eede035:6

value
30356014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ec64114ffc76a98778361311b44d141f5a18bf8e OP_EQUAL
address
3PEwGdrsHNm7tJCfHb2HUEE5L3w7gPvPax
transaction
38c8feed0e18cc12579aeeca6d98a7aa28873722dbc43d9139d78acd1eede035
spent
true